2026 marks the 50th anniversary of the Thayer Annual Fund—launched in 1976 as the "Dean's Fund" by Dean Carl Long and Thayer's Board of Advisors, including dedicated board member and lifelong Thayer and Dartmouth supporter, Barry McLean '60 Th'61.
The vision was simple and powerful: to provide annual, flexible support to enhance the student experience and help drive innovation across Thayer. In its first year, the fund raised $15,000—a modest but meaningful beginning.
Today, five decades later, that vision has grown exponentially. In the 2025 fiscal year, the Thayer Annual Fund raised an extraordinary $1.86 million, thanks to the generosity of many alumni, families, and friends.

Albert W. Doolittle Jr. Giving Society Albert W. Doolittle Jr. '36 Th'37 never missed a gift to the Thayer Annual Fund since its establishment in 1976. In his honor, donors who give to the Annual Fund for at least five consecutive years, or every year since their Thayer School graduation, are recognized with membership in the Albert W. Doolittle Society.
